Dáil Éireann Debate, Thursday - 19 April 2018

Thursday, 19 April 2018

Questions (243)

Niall Collins

Question:

243. Deputy Niall Collins asked the Minister for Health the way in which the HSE will assess and monitor the risks to human health in view of the fact that An Bord Pleanála has approved a company's (details supplied) application for an incinerator at a location and in view of the levels of pulmonary mortality in Limerick city and county; the programme of action the HSE will take to measure and manage the increased health risks to the population in the vicinity of the planned incinerator; the provision that will be made for increased expenditure should County Limerick's position as the national blackspot for pulmonary mortality continue to deteriorate;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[17210/18]

View answer

Written answers

This is a matter for the HSE therefore I have referred the question to the HSE for attention and direct reply.
